Barking Pyranees
I'm hoping that someone here can give some suggestions on how to teach my
Great Pyranees not to bark...or at least to reduce it! KC is a 14 month male, non-neutered Pyr who has perfected barking ! Luckily we live in the country with no neighbours to get upset, but the barking is driving us crazy. Some days he is great, hardly no noise from him at all, and yet at other times he will constantly bark with no obvious stimulus....I guess something is bothering him but it's not obvious to us. When outdoors he is tied up with a 60ft long chain that gives him pleny of space to roam, when indoors he has freedom to go where ever he wants. No matter where he is he will bark, indoors, outdoors, you name it. Things we have tried: Spray water in face Muzzle Put him in his crate Keep him indoors Keep him outdoors Electric shock collar so far nothing works. The barking is so bad that the next step is to send him back to the breeder, because it is driving us crazy. Hellllpppp. |
